A Family-Friendly Adventure in Paris

Friday, October 6: Exploring the City

Start your family adventure in Paris by visiting the iconic Eiffel Tower in the morning. Take an elevator ride to the top for stunning panoramic views of the city. Afterward, head to the nearby Champ de Mars park for a relaxing picnic lunch. In the afternoon, immerse yourself in art and culture at the Louvre Museum, home to famous masterpieces like the Mona Lisa. For the evening, take a leisurely boat cruise along the Seine River, admiring the illuminated landmarks of Paris.

  • Eiffel Tower: Cost estimate - €25 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Champ de Mars: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Louvre Museum: Cost estimate - €15 per person, Time spent - 3-4 hours
  • Seine River Cruise: Cost estimate - €15-20 per person,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Saturday, October 7: Magical Disney Experience

Dedicate this day to experiencing the magic of Disneyland Paris. Spend the entire day exploring the two parks, Disneyland Park and Walt Disney Studios Park. Enjoy thrilling rides, enchanting shows, and meet your favorite Disney characters. Don't miss the magical parade and the spectacular fireworks display in the evening.

  • Disneyland Paris: Cost estimate - €79 per person (1-day ticket), Time spent - Full day
Sunday, October 8: Historical and Cultural Highlights

Start your day by visiting the majestic Notre-Dame Cathedral. Explore the beautiful interior and climb to the top for a breathtaking view of the city. Afterward, head to the historic Marais district, known for its charming streets, boutique shops, and trendy cafes. In the afternoon, visit the Centre Pompidou, a contemporary art museum that houses an impressive collection. End your day with a stroll along the picturesque Canal Saint-Martin, where you can enjoy a boat ride or have a picnic.

  • Notre-Dame Cathedral: Free entry, €10 to climb to the top,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Marais District: Free,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Centre Pompidou: Cost estimate - €14 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Canal Saint-Martin: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Monday, October 9: Gardens and Museums

Start your day at the beautiful Jardin du Luxembourg, where you can relax and enjoy the serene atmosphere. From there, visit the Musée d'Orsay, an art museum housed in a former railway station, showcasing a vast collection of Impressionist and Post-Impressionist masterpieces. In the afternoon, explore the Montmartre neighborhood, famous for its bohemian vibe and the iconic Sacré-Cœur Basilica. End your trip with a visit to the interactive and educational Cité des Sciences et de l'Industrie.

  • Jardin du Luxembourg: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Musée d'Orsay: Cost estimate - €14 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Montmartre: Free,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Cité des Sciences et de l'Industrie: Cost estimate - €12 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

When in Paris, make sure to explore the charming neighborhood of Le Marais. This historic district is filled with narrow cobblestone streets, beautiful architecture, and unique boutiques. It's a great place to grab a delicious crepe from a local vendor and spend some time people-watching at one of the many cafes. Another local favorite is Parc de la Villette, a vast park with futuristic architecture, outdoor activities, and the Cité des Enfants, an interactive children's museum. It's the perfect place for families to enjoy a picnic and relax amidst nature.
